Python中的图灵机器人
首先在图灵机器人的官网注册一个帐号,然后创建一个机器人,接下来进行下面的操作,就可以与机器人进行对话了。
代码块:
import requestsdef get_tuling_respose(_info):print(_info)api_url = 'http://www.tuling123.com/openapi/api'data = {'key':'f90956d3a9f947be95ec28e02a52ce58','info':_info,'userid':'lily'}res = requests.post(api_url,data).json()# print(res,type(res))print(res['text'])return (res['text'])get_tuling_respose('给我讲个笑话')
程序及运行结果:
为了实现手机扫码登陆微信后,自己的微信帐号可以成为机器人,从而进行自动回复,我们可以通过下面的代码实现。
代码块:
import itchat
import requestsdef get_tuling_respose(_info):print(_info)api_url = 'http://www.tuling123.com/openapi/api'data = {'key':'f90956d3a9f947be95ec28e02a52ce58','info':_info,'userid':'lily'}res = requests.post(api_url,data).json()print(res['text'])return (res['text'])
@itchat.msg_register(itchat.content.TEXT,isFriendChat=True)
def text_reply(msg):content = msg['Content']returnContent = get_tuling_respose(content)return returnContentitchat.auto_login()
itchat.run()
程序及运行结果:
当执行完代码后系统会自动出现一个二维码,如下所示:
当我们扫码登陆成功后,我的好友给我发消息,图铃机器人就会自动回复;当我给文件助手发送消息,文件助手也会自动会消息给我,此记录只会显示在python中,如下所示:
Python中的图灵机器人相关推荐
- 图灵机器人 mysql_如何在微信小程序中制作图灵机器人?
本教程讲解了如何在微信小程序中制作图灵机器人?操作起来是很简单的,想要学习的朋友们可以跟着小编一起去看一看下文,希望能够帮助到大家. 开发环境及框架 后端:国产java极速框架JFinal(超级好用有 ...
- ROS语音交互系统_(3)ROS中接入图灵机器人语音理解系统
前言 图灵机器人官网 1.提前安装依赖包 $ sudo apt install libcurl3 libcurl4-oppenssl-dev $ sudo apt install libjsoncpp ...
- 微信公众号中接入图灵机器人
首先打开图灵机器人网址:在百度搜索"图灵机器人",进入官网 1.点击注册按钮,进行注册: 2.注册成功后,就可以创建自己的机器人了 选择创建机器人: 我是在微信公众号中聊天使用的, ...
- 使用Python与图灵机器人聊天
CSDN广告邮件太多了,邮箱已经屏蔽了CSDN,留言请转SegmentFault:https://segmentfault.com/a/1190000013900291 图灵机器人对中文的识别准确率高 ...
- 使用Python与图灵机器人聊天 1
图灵机器人对中文的识别准确率高达90%,是目前中文语境下智能度最高的机器人.有很多在Python中使用图灵机器人API的博客,但都是1.0版本.所以今天简单地总结一下在Python中使用图灵机器人AP ...
- PHP-微信开发之图灵机器人--天气接口调用
微信开发中,图灵机器人回复.天气.翻译.美食.地图.二维码功能,随处可见.大小网站.APP都在运用这项技术在项目中.今天简单介绍一下图灵机器人回复,天气接口调用.翻译接口,希望对朋友们有用. 效果案例 ...
- 使用图灵机器人实现虚拟客服
我们经常看到各个app上的客服都带有自动文字识别和自动回复的功能,难道是每个公司都维护一套自己的人工智能客服系统,显然不是.可能词库是公司设计,但是技术是使用的第三方的人工智能机器人.今天,我们来看看 ...
- 图灵机器人调用数据恢复_机器人也能撩妹?python程序员自制微信机器人,替他俘获女神芳心...
机器人也有感情 还记得王传君饰演的<星语心愿之再爱>这部电影吗?王传君饰演的天才程序员"王鹏鹏"因工作原因不能陪伴照顾身在异地的女朋友"林亦男",呆 ...
- python编程控制机器人_基于Python开发的微信图灵机器人
在过去的几个月中,由于在新生群中回答问题费时费力,同时又有许多重复而又有固定答案的回答,我受到一些知乎文章的启发,维护了一个基于itchat的群聊机器人.从刚开始接入图灵机器人时只会尬聊的机器人,之后 ...
最新文章
- linux wc 命令简介
- js,jquery 根据对象某一属性进行排序
- 关于Quartz.NET作业调度框架的一点小小的封装,实现伪AOP写LOG功能
- 堆排序(利用最大堆)
- 【DP】滑雪场的缆车(jzoj 1257)
- rocketmq 有哪些监控工具_Kafka和RocketMQ底层存储之那些你不知道的事
- anime studio的本质特性
- MySQL 连接报错:mysql access denied for user@ip
- 栈溢出脚本_污点分析挖掘漏洞演示——如何在8小时内从零发现cve20120158(word溢出漏洞)...
- mysql连接查询_.net core 里连接mysql查询数据的方法
- win10 LTSC系统 安装应用商店和纸牌合集,解决从应用商店安装Solitaire Collection纸牌打开空白的问题
- linux php pdo dblib,PDO_DBLIB (MSSQL) on Ubuntu Server
- matlab中的高阶导数,如何用matlab求函数的导数与高阶导数 需要技巧
- Delphi入门教程
- 微信安装包 11 年膨胀 575 倍?QQ安装包800M?谁在抢你的手机内存?
- mimics能导出什么格式_mimics教程
- linux 类似winscp_linux 类似 winscp
- pythonapp爬虫库_python爬虫抓取app列表的图标
- 增加8g服务器虚拟内存,电脑如何增加虚拟内存,8g虚拟内存设置多少好?
- 使用 setoolkit 伪造站点窃取用户信息
热门文章
- 大数据之_SCALA工作笔记001---Centos7.3安装scala
- java框架实例---自定义标签实例
- filter2D函数的.depth()变量的设定
- 杭电4500小Q系列故事——屌丝的逆袭
- 手把手教你安装 FastAdmin 到虚拟主机 (phpStudy)
- python 描述符参考文档_python 描述符详解
- python列表删除算法_关于算法:如何从python中的列表中删除重复的条目
- 随想录(从DO-178C和ARINC653想到的)
- 嵌入式操作系统内核原理和开发(地址空间)
- java怎么拦截数据库查询结果_关于mybatis拦截器,有谁知道怎么对结果集进行拦截,将指定字段查询结果进行格式化...